Beautiful Country Pub in the Peak District is seeking a Sous Chef or strong Line Chef to join our tight-knit kitchen team. Our menu focuses on hearty, seasonal dishes made with locally sourced ingredients.

Salary: Β£38,000 - Β£45,000 (DOE) including tips - Live-in

Location: Peak District, Derbyshire

Accommodation: Live-in available (private room/shared house)

Job Type: Full Time / Fixed Term

Start Date: ASAP

Whats in it for you:

  • Competitive salary + tips
  • Live-in accommodation available
  • Supportive, friendly team
  • Fair rotas with proper time off, no splits, consecutive days off
  • Work in a beautiful countryside setting

What we’re looking for:

  • Proven experience in a busy kitchen (ideally high volume)
  • A calm, reliable chef with good standards
  • Able to support the Head Chef with service, stock, and team management
  • Positive, clean, and professional approach

We welcome chefs from across the UK. Staff accommodation makes this perfect for someone relocating or looking for a lifestyle change. To apply, send your CV or message us with your background. Immediate trials available.
